It is crucial to determine the underlying cause of a technical issue before attempting to resolve it.
As opposed to only treating the symptoms, this step is essential because it enables you to address the underlying problem. You can stop the issue from happening again by figuring out its underlying cause. To determine the underlying cause of an IT issue, take the following actions:1. Information gathering: To begin, try to learn as much as you can about the issue. The more details you can provide, the easier it will be to identify the root cause.
What were you doing when the issue happened? Have you recently made any changes to your device or installed any new software? 2. Examine the symptoms in greater detail: Pay particular attention to the signs of the issue. Knowing the symptoms, such as whether the device is freezing or crashing or if there is a specific error message, will help you narrow down the potential causes.
Three. Prior to delving into intricate troubleshooting methods, determine whether there are any common problems. Sometimes the issue is as simple as a loose cable or a weak Wi-Fi signal. Are you sure the device is plugged in? Is the internet connection stable? 4.
Utilize the diagnostic tools that are built into many devices to find the source of an issue. These tools can identify the issue by running tests, scanning for hardware problems, & looking for software conflicts. 5. Investigate and consult resources: Don’t be afraid to contact tech support or consult internet resources if you can’t figure out the underlying cause on your own. Technology troubleshooting is the subject of innumerable forums, websites, and communities.
It’s likely that someone else has faced a problem comparable to yours & has discovered a fix. Finding the source of the problem is vital, but so is having a toolkit of fundamental troubleshooting methods. With these tips, you can quickly fix common tech issues and get your devices back up and operating.
The following fundamental troubleshooting methods are essential for all to know:1. Restarting the device: Although it might seem straightforward, restarting your device can frequently resolve a variety of issues. Restarting the device resets its memory, ends any open processes, and brings the system up to date. 2. Software updates frequently include bug fixes & performance enhancements.
Check for updates. You can lessen the chance of running into issues by making sure your device is running the most recent version of the software by routinely checking for updates. 3. Examining connections and cables: Poor or loose cables can result in a number of problems, such as losing power or internet access.
Verify that all of the cables are firmly plugged in & look for any obvious damage. Also, make sure the right network or peripheral is connected to your device. 4. Checking for malware and viruses: Malware & viruses can seriously damage your device, making it crash, lag, or act strangely. To quickly find and eliminate any malicious software from your device, use reliable antivirus software to scan it. Error messages are frequently encountered during tech troubleshooting.

Among the most frequent technological issues that users encounter are those related to internet connectivity. Solving internet connectivity problems is crucial, regardless of whether you’re having trouble connecting to the internet or are just getting slow speeds. To get you going, here are some fundamental troubleshooting procedures:1.
Verify that your device is linked to the correct Ethernet cable or Wi-Fi network by checking your network connection. Devices may occasionally connect to an alternate network on their own, which can lead to connectivity problems. 2. To restart your router, unplug it from the power source, give it a few seconds, & then re-plug it. Often, small connectivity problems can be fixed with this easy step. 3. Make sure your Wi-Fi signal is not being interfered with by other electronics, such as microwaves and cordless phones.
To reduce interference, move your router away from such devices or try a different Wi-Fi channel. 4. Update the firmware on your router: Router firmware upgrades have the same potential to enhance functionality and resolve bugs as software updates for your device. For instructions on how to install any updates that may be available, visit the manufacturer’s website.
It can be very annoying to have a slow computer, especially when you’re trying to work or relax. Numerous issues, such as incompatible software, overly active background processes, and hardware limitations, can contribute to slow computer performance. To help your computer run faster, try these simple troubleshooting steps:1. Close any unneeded programs: Too many open programs can tax the resources of your computer & cause it to lag.
Just keep the apps you need to complete the task at hand; close any others. 2. Eliminate temporary files: Your computer will eventually gather these files, which can impede performance and eat up important storage space. To get rid of these files and make space, use the integrated Disk Cleanup tool or an outside program. 3. Look for malware: Malware and viruses can seriously affect the functionality of your computer.
To find and get rid of any malicious software, perform a thorough scan with a reliable antivirus program. 4. Upgrade hardware: You should think about upgrading your hardware if your computer is still sluggish after trying some simple troubleshooting techniques. Performance can be greatly increased by increasing RAM, switching to a solid-state drive (SSD) in place of the hard drive, or upgrading the CPU. For most users, installing software is a routine task, but it can occasionally be frustrating. Compatibility problems, insufficient system requirements, or corrupted installation files can all lead to problems with software installations. To fix issues with software installation, follow these simple troubleshooting steps: 1.
Verify that your device satisfies the minimum system requirements before installing any software. Software installation errors can be caused by outdated operating systems, incompatible hardware, or insufficient RAM. 2. Turn off your antivirus program: Occasionally, antivirus programs can obstruct installations by labeling safe files as dangerous. Turn off your antivirus program for a while, then try installing the program once more. Three.
To run an installation file as an administrator, right-click on it and choose “Run as administrator.”. This can help resolve permission-related issues and grants the installation process elevated privileges. 4. Download a new copy: Obtaining a new copy from the official website can fix issues with corrupted or incomplete installation files. Download a fresh installation file and remove the current one. Paper jams and connectivity issues are just a couple of the headaches that printers are known for causing.
Although diagnosing printer problems can be difficult, you can frequently fix the issue by following some simple troubleshooting procedures. The following are some typical printer problems and their fixes:1. Paper jams: Printer paper jams are a frequent occurrence. In order to unjam a piece of paper, carefully take it out without tearing it. Take a look for any paper remnants that might be the source of the jam. 2.
Check the cables and connections if your printer is having trouble connecting to your computer or network. Make sure the USB or Ethernet cable is firmly attached & that the printer is plugged in correctly. Verify that the wireless printer you’re using is linked to the appropriate Wi-Fi network before using it. 3. Updating printer drivers can help prevent printing issues caused by outdated or incompatible printer drivers.
The most recent drivers for your printer model can be downloaded by visiting the manufacturer’s website. After installing the drivers, restart your system. 4. Print job queue clearing: If a specific print job is causing your printer to become unresponsive, try clearing the print queue. Restart the printer, cancel any pending print jobs, and open the print queue on your PC.
Smartphones and tablets, among other mobile devices, have become indispensable in our daily lives. Still, they are not impervious to issues. Mobile device issues can be annoying, ranging from app crashes to battery drain. These fundamental troubleshooting techniques can be used to resolve typical issues with mobile devices: 1.
Restart your device: Restarting your mobile device can frequently fix minor issues, just like it does with computers. When the restart option appears, press & hold the power button. 2. Clear the app cache: App cache can build up over time, slowing down your device or resulting in crashes. Navigate to the settings menu, choose the app whose cache you wish to empty, and then press the “Clear Cache” button. Three.
Update your apps: Bug patches & performance enhancements are frequently included in app updates. Go to the updates section of your device’s app store, open it, and install any available updates for your apps. 4. Factory reset: You might need to do a factory reset if everything else doesn’t work and your device is still having issues. A factory reset will erase all of the data and settings on your device, so be sure to back up your information before doing so. While many tech issues can be solved with simple troubleshooting techniques, there are some situations that call for more sophisticated methods.
Advanced troubleshooting methods may call for specialized equipment or experience and require a deeper understanding of the hardware or software. A few instances of sophisticated troubleshooting methods are as follows: 1. System restore: You can return your computer to a time when it was operating properly if it is having ongoing problems. You can reverse system modifications using system restore without compromising your personal files. 2.
Driver updates: From software crashes to hardware malfunctions, outdated or incompatible drivers can lead to a number of problems. Expert users can manually update drivers by downloading the most recent versions from the manufacturer’s website. 3. Advanced troubleshooting tasks can be carried out with the aid of command line tools, like the macOS Terminal or the Windows Command Prompt.
With the aid of these tools, users can run commands designed to identify & resolve particular problems. 4. Hardware diagnostics: To test and diagnose hardware problems, advanced users can make use of specialized hardware diagnostic tools. These instruments are able to offer comprehensive details regarding the functionality and state of various hardware parts.
